Overview and realism for Uttar Pradesh growers
Hops (Humulus lupulus) are a perennial vine traditionally grown in temperate regions. Growing hops in Uttar Pradesh (UP) is possible on a small or trial scale if you select the right site, manage irrigation and shade, and prepare for vigorous trellis work. This guide focuses on pragmatic steps you can implement on-farm rather than academic theory.
Is hops suitable for UP’s climate?
Hops prefer long daylight hours in summer, well-drained soils and cold dormancy to set good cones. Much of UP is subtropical with hot summers and mild winters, so commercial-scale production like in Europe or the Pacific Northwest is challenging. However, you can successfully grow hops in UP by:
- choosing sheltered sites with some seasonal coolness (higher elevation or near rivers can help)
- using irrigation and shade management to reduce heat stress in peak summer
- selecting vigorous varieties and planning for one-off experimental plantings rather than immediate large-scale monoculture
Site selection and soil
Choose a site with these characteristics:
- Full sun for most of the day, but protection from afternoon extremes (east- or north-facing rows or light shading can reduce heat stress).
- Well-drained loam or sandy-loam soils; hops will not tolerate waterlogged soils. If your field is heavy clay, build raised beds or improve drainage.
- Soil pH 6.0–7.0 is ideal. Correct acid soils with agricultural lime after soil testing.
- Good wind protection. Strong winds can shred bines and cones; plant windbreaks or use stout trellis and guy lines.
Choosing planting material and varieties
Hops are usually planted from rhizomes or root-cuttings (clonal). In UP, availability of certified rhizomes may be limited. Options:
- Source healthy rhizomes from reliable nurseries or research stations where possible. Avoid buying uncertified material that could carry virus.
- Common commercial varieties abroad include Cascade, Nugget, Fuggle and Tettnang; these are temperate varieties and may require adaptation trials in UP. If you can source them, plant small trial plots first and monitor performance.
- Consider planting multiple varieties to identify which performs best locally; vigor, pest resistance and cone production can vary by clone.
Planting: timing, spacing and technique
Timing:
- In UP you can plant rhizomes at the start of the rainy season (May–July) so the young plants benefit from soil moisture. Avoid planting in the hottest peak months without irrigation.
Spacing and layout:
- Plan rows spaced 2.5–3.0 metres apart to allow equipment access and air circulation.
- Plant rhizomes 0.5–1.0 metres apart within the row to produce strong hills of bines. For commercial yields, use 1 metre spacing; for trials closer spacing can accelerate canopy closure.
- Plant rhizomes horizontally about 5–10 cm deep, buds up. Water immediately and mulch to conserve moisture.
Trellis and training
Hops are climbing bines rather than true vines and need sturdy support. Trellis recommendations:
- Height: 4–5 metres is standard. In UP you may prefer 3.5–4 metres if wind exposure or cost is an issue, but taller trellises increase yield per plant.
- Construction: use strong poles (steel, treated timber or bamboo with adequate bracing), with crosswires or strings trained from the crown to the top support. Use biodegradable twine or Sisal twine tied in a clockwise spiral for the bine to grab.
- Row orientation: orient rows north–south where possible to maximise sunlight exposure along the day.
- Training: in the first season, allow a few strong shoots per crown and wrap them clockwise around the twine. Remove weak shoots so only 2–4 main bines climb per plant in later seasons.
Irrigation and water management
Hops need regular moisture during shoot growth and cone development, but are sensitive to waterlogging:
- Keep soil evenly moist—an inch of water per week during active growth is a general guide; increase during very hot, dry spells.
- Drip irrigation is the most water- and labour-efficient choice; it also reduces foliar disease risk compared with overhead irrigation.
- Mulch around crowns to reduce evaporation and keep soil temperature stable.
Nutrition and fertiliser program
Hops are heavy feeders, especially of nitrogen in spring and potassium during cone development. Start with a soil test and tailor rates, but a practical programme might look like:
- Pre-plant: incorporate well-rotted farmyard manure or compost to 20–30 t/ha equivalent in the planting strip.
- Vegetative growth (spring–early summer): apply higher nitrogen sources (split applications) to encourage strong bine growth.
- Cone development: reduce N and increase K and P to support lupulin formation and cone quality.
- Micronutrients: monitor for deficiencies (zinc, iron) and correct with foliar sprays when needed.
Agronomic note: do not over-apply nitrogen late in the season; excessive vegetative growth can delay maturity and increase disease pressure.
Pruning, training and canopy management
Annual routine:
- Spring: remove old bines and dead material before new shoots emerge. This reduces disease inoculum.
- Early growth: thin shoots so 2–4 healthy bines remain per crown and train those up the support.
- During the season: manage side shoots and leaves to improve air flow and light to cones. Remove shaded lower shoots to reduce disease risk.
Pests and diseases: practical control
Common issues to watch for and integrate into management:
- Aphids: can damage bines and transmit viruses. Use insecticidal soaps, neem oil or release predators (ladybirds) in small plantings. Avoid indiscriminate insecticide use that kills beneficials.
- Spider mites: monitor under hot, dry conditions. Maintain good canopy humidity and use miticides only when thresholds are exceeded.
- Downy mildew and powdery mildew: these fungal-like diseases can be a problem where humidity is high. Improve air flow, avoid overhead irrigation, remove infected shoots, and use copper or permitted fungicides as a last resort following label directions.
- Root rot: Ensure drainage and do not overwater. Plant healthy rhizomes and avoid replanting into infected beds without sanitation.
- Viruses: show as stunting or mosaic symptoms. Remove and destroy infected plants; use certified planting material to prevent spread.
Adopt integrated pest management (IPM): monitor regularly, use thresholds to decide interventions, and favour cultural and biological controls first.
Harvesting, drying and storage
When to harvest:
- Cones are ready when they feel papery and spring back slightly, the lupulin glands inside are yellow and fragrant, and stems inside the cone are brown rather than green. Pick a few cones and rub them to check lupulin colour and aroma.
Harvest tips:
- Harvest by hand or machine depending on scale. Pick in the cooler part of the day to reduce heat stress on oil content;
- Process quickly: hops lose aroma and alpha acids after picking if left moist or warm.
Drying and storage:
- Dry to 8–10% moisture using a forced-air drier or low-temperature oven/solar drier. Avoid temperatures above 60°C which can damage oils.
- Once dry, cool and pack in airtight bags with oxygen absorbers if possible and store at low temperature and away from light to preserve alpha acids and aroma.
Post-harvest uses and marketing
Small-scale markets in UP may include craft breweries, home brewers and flavour industries. Start by building local relationships with microbreweries or brewing hobbyist clubs. Label quality by noting variety, alpha acid range (if you can test), and harvest date—brewers value freshness and consistency.
Economics and scaling considerations
Hops require a significant up-front investment in trellis and labour. For UP growers, a sensible approach is to start with a pilot plot (0.1–0.5 ha) to understand local variety performance, irrigation needs and pest pressures before scaling. Keep good records on yields, inputs and quality so you can refine practices.
Practical tips from field experience
- Run small trials of several varieties and record which handle UP summers best—vigour and disease resistance matter more than fame.
- Invest in a durable trellis; cheap supports that fail under wind cost more in the long run.
- Use drip irrigation and mulch to protect against heat stress and reduce disease pressure from overhead watering.
- Train workers on how to judge cone readiness—harvesting too early or late reduces value.
- Collaborate with local breweries from year two so you can adapt variety choice and harvest timing to market demand.
